Apprenticeship Training Fund Law

Did you know that ALL Maryland state-funded prevailing wage projects exceeding $100,000 must participate in the Maryland Apprenticeship Training Fund? Prince George's County Rapid Re-Employment Grants

NEW PROGRAM: Prince George's County is distributing over $5,000,000 to businesses in the metro Washington, DC area in need and who are hiring unemployed Prince George's County residents. This program provides small businesses with grants covering 75% of a new employee’s salary, and large businesses are eligible for grants covering 50% of a new hire’s salary for the first 12 weeks of their employment. more >
